#0d0383 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d0383 is composed of 5.1% red, 1.2%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 26.3%. #0d0383 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a06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#0d0383 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d0383 has RGB values of R:13, G:3,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 852867.

Shades and Tints of #0d0383
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020010 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d0383
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414145 is the less saturated color, while #0d0383 is the most saturated one.
